Primary Study for Control of Lonsdalea Canker of Poplar

Abstract: To explore the method for the control of Lonsdalea canker of poplar, based on the plate dilution method, 86 bacterial strains were isolated from rhizosphere soil of trees with Lonsdalea canker of poplar. Dual culture experiments results showed that 5 bacterial strains were of antibacterial activities against the pathogen Lonsdalea quercina. Control experiments with cutting indoor and trees in the field indicated that strains P2 and P4 were more effective than the other 3 strains, and control effectiveness in field can reach to 51.8% and 48.6% respectively. Strain P2 was identified as Bacillus subtilis, and the strain P4 was Streptomyces venezuelae. Four kinds of antibiotics and 2 kinds of fungicides were used to test inhibition effectiveness against the pathogen with dual culture experiments. Zhongshengmycin and Xinzhi had no obvious antibacterial effectiveness against the pathogen whereas polyoxin, streptomycin, ethylicin and amobam had. 100-fold dilution of agricultural streptomycin had better control effectiveness, prevention rate can reach to 38.2%. The experiments provided primary an approach for control of Lonsdalea canker of poplar.
